The Evolution of LinkedIn Learning
LinkedIn Learning origins may be found at Lynda.com, a popular online learning platform founded in 1995. In 2015, LinkedIn acquired Lynda.com and integrated its vast library of courses into the LinkedIn ecosystem. This merger resulted in the birth of LinkedIn Learning, combining the power of professional networking with high-quality educational content.

LinkedIn Premium Subscriptions
LinkedIn Premium subscriptions are separate from LinkedIn Learning but can be bundled with it for an enhanced experience. While the primary focus of LinkedIn Premium is on networking and job-related features, it complements the learning experience on LinkedIn Learning. Here's an overview of the Premium subscription options:
Premium Business:
Aimed at professionals who want to expand their network and build stronger relationships with other professionals.
It provides advanced search filters, expanded profile views, and additional messaging capabilities.
Sales Navigator:
Tailored for sales professionals and teams looking to optimize their outreach and prospecting efforts.
It offers lead recommendations, advanced search filters, and CRM integration.
Recruiter Lite:
Geared towards recruiters and talent acquisition professionals.
It includes advanced search and filtering options, expanded access to candidate profiles, and team collaboration tools.
Each Premium subscription tier comes with its own pricing structure and benefits.
